Bridgeton, Portland, OR Guía Local

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Bridgeton?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Bridgeton | $1,231 | $975 | $2,046 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Bridgeton | $1,567 | $941 | $1,975 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Bridgeton | $2,165 | $1,428 | $6,471 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Bridgeton | $2,477 | $1,760 | $3,195 |
